@charset "utf-8";
#left_nav {
	width: 60px;
	height: 244px;
	position: fixed;
	left: 50%;
	margin-left: -680px;
	top: 50%;
	margin-top: -122px;
	list-style: none;
	display: none;
}
*html #left_nav {
	position: absolute;
top:expression(documentElement.scrollTop + 0 + "px");
}
#left_nav li {
	height: 60px;
	width: 60px;
	text-align: center;
	margin-bottom: 1px;
	background-color: #FFF;
}
#left_nav a {
	display: block;
	font-size: 12px;
	height: 20px;
	padding-top: 40px;
	text-decoration: none;
	-webkit-transition: all 0s ease-in-out;
	-moz-transition: all 0s ease-in-out;
	-o-transition: all 0s ease-in-out;
	transition: all 0s ease-in-out;
}
#left_nav a:hover {
	background-color: #FFF;
	background-position: center 4px;
	color: #FFBB31;
}
#left_nav li.ln1 a {
	background-image: url(../../images/float_nav1.png);
	background-repeat: no-repeat;
	background-position: left 2px;
}
#left_nav li.ln1 a:hover {
	background-color: #FFF;
	background-position: center 2px;
}
#left_nav li.ln2 a {
	background-image: url(../../images/float_nav2.png);
	background-repeat: no-repeat;
	background-position: left 2px;
}
#left_nav li.ln2 a:hover {
	background-color: #FFF;
	background-position: center 2px;
}
#left_nav li.ln3 a {
	background-image: url(../../images/float_nav3.png);
	background-repeat: no-repeat;
	background-position: left 2px;
}
#left_nav li.ln3 a:hover {
	background-color: #FFF;
	background-position: center 2px;
}
#left_nav li.ln4 a {
	background-image: url(../../images/float_nav4.png);
	background-repeat: no-repeat;
	background-position: left 2px;
}
#left_nav li.ln4 a:hover {
	background-color: #FFF;
	background-position: center 2px;
}
#left_nav li.current a {
	background-color: #FFBB31;
	background-position: right 2px;
	color: #FFF;
}
#left_nav li.current a:hover {
	background-color: #FFBB31;
	background-position: right 2px;
	color: #FFF;
}